Revision: 148793 https://trac.macports.org/changeset/148793 Author: devans@macports.org Date: 2016-05-18 05:27:11 -0700 (Wed, 18 May 2016) Log Message: ----------- ffmpeg-devel: build fix for 10.6 and earlier, kAudioFormatMPEG4AAC_ELD only available 10.7+. Modified Paths: -------------- trunk/dports/multimedia/ffmpeg-devel/Portfile Added Paths: ----------- trunk/dports/multimedia/ffmpeg-devel/files/patch-libavcodec-audiotoolboxenc.c.diff Modified: trunk/dports/multimedia/ffmpeg-devel/Portfile =================================================================== --- trunk/dports/multimedia/ffmpeg-devel/Portfile 2016-05-18 11:19:07 UTC (rev 148792) +++ trunk/dports/multimedia/ffmpeg-devel/Portfile 2016-05-18 12:27:11 UTC (rev 148793) @@ -84,6 +84,8 @@ port:xz \ port:zlib +patchfiles patch-libavcodec-audiotoolboxenc.c.diff + # # enable auto configure of asm optimizations # requires Xcode 3.1 or better on Leopard Added: trunk/dports/multimedia/ffmpeg-devel/files/patch-libavcodec-audiotoolboxenc.c.diff =================================================================== --- trunk/dports/multimedia/ffmpeg-devel/files/patch-libavcodec-audiotoolboxenc.c.diff (rev 0) +++ trunk/dports/multimedia/ffmpeg-devel/files/patch-libavcodec-audiotoolboxenc.c.diff 2016-05-18 12:27:11 UTC (rev 148793) @@ -0,0 +1,13 @@ +--- libavcodec/audiotoolboxenc.c.orig 2016-05-18 05:07:43.000000000 -0700 ++++ libavcodec/audiotoolboxenc.c 2016-05-18 05:09:16.000000000 -0700 +@@ -61,8 +61,10 @@ + return kAudioFormatMPEG4AAC_HE_V2; + case FF_PROFILE_AAC_LD: + return kAudioFormatMPEG4AAC_LD; ++#if MAC_OS_X_VERSION_MAX_ALLOWED >= 1070 + case FF_PROFILE_AAC_ELD: + return kAudioFormatMPEG4AAC_ELD; ++#endif + } + case AV_CODEC_ID_ADPCM_IMA_QT: + return kAudioFormatAppleIMA4;
participants (1)
-
devans@macports.org